I try to trench in a straight line whenever possible and identify sections (i.e.: pole to pole). Perhaps markers at both sides of your garden could be used to determine the line.

No kidding! That's the cheapest and easiest. I put a patio block flush with the ground in my lawn on both sides of my driveway where an irrigation line crosses so I know where to find it if needed. I put a patio block flush with the ground over my septic tank so I know where to find it. And over my washing machine leach field. And at both ends of a water line out to the garden, and at the turns. Its easy, cheap and unobtrusive. You could use 4x4 posts on each side of your garden. Hang a birdhouse on it.
